The site, off Fort Armistead Road just over the Baltimore City line, is owned by Millennium Inorganic Chemicals, which has applied to modify its permit to allow fly ash to be dumped at the site.
The plan concerns Anne Arundel County officials and area residents who said Constellation and state regulators have left them in the dark.
